Opis

The initial novel in the acclaimed Outlander series, which has been transformed into a popular TV series, introduces readers to an intriguing narrative where the past becomes the future. In the year 1945, Claire Randall visits the Scottish Highlands with her spouse, Frank, seeking a second honeymoon and an opportunity to reconnect post-war. During this journey, Claire unexpectedly passes through a circle of standing stones, finding herself transported to the year 1743. There, she encounters a British officer, none other than the ancestor of her husband, Frank, from six generations back. Stranded in a world filled with peril, desire, and aggression, Claire's safety is intertwined with Jamie Fraser, a courageous young Scottish warrior. As their relationship evolves from necessity to an intense connection, Claire becomes divided between two vastly contrasting men and the disparate lives they represent.
